WebAccording to the FMCSA's own hearing requirements: “A person is physically qualified to drive a CMV if that person: First perceives a forced whispered voice in the better ear at not less than five feet with or without the use of a hearing aid….” This brings us to the question of what exactly a “forced whisper” is. If you are deaf, hard of hearing, or have a speech disability, please dial 7-1-1 to access ... WebWhat are the hearing requirements for a DOT physical? The driver must be able to perceive a forced whispered voice in one ear, the better ear, at not less than five feet with or without the use of a hearing aid. If the driver fails the whisper test, the medical examiner will refer the driver to have an audiometry test.
